Transaction de3554bcc21321b9d7777da1e143e8bff34b532e29d86c53d233fec9f3eccb95
1 Input
1 Output
-
de3554bcc21321b9d7777da1e143e8bff34b532e29d86c53d233fec9f3eccb95:0
- value
- 5053591
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d3daadf19680ae267c2a28d548cfe7f0f785309
- address
- bc1q95764hcedq9wye7z52x4fr870u8hs5cfkmcym7